- [ ] **Step 7: Breaker override escrow.** After sealing the signing keys for the Tallgrove upstream API circuit breaker, confirm the support team can force the breaker open during a full outage. The override bundle lives in the sealed escrow drawer and is useless without its unlock phrase. Two ceremony witnesses must initial this step before proceeding. The escrow bundle is decrypted with the recovery passphrase that follows.

vault phrase of kahip-kahop = holath-quenmir

Meeting notes (excerpt) — Fennick property transfer, Tuesday session

Attendees agreed the notarised deed for the Ambervale site is complete and counter-stamped. The original must travel to the Caldwick registry office before Friday's lodgement deadline; only the original is acceptable. The office manager will arrange a bonded courier for Thursday morning. The courier's hand-over instruction was recorded as follows.

dispatch memo: the lamwyn fenwyn courier leaves the wenir ledger at gate 7175 under passcode 822969

As our incoming director joins next week, this summarises the Brindlevale reseller programme. We onboarded fourteen regional resellers across the Calder Basin territory, with tiered margins reviewed quarterly. The accreditation portal launches in March; training materials are drafted and awaiting legal sign-off. Two underperforming accounts in Northerby are flagged for a renewal decision. Please review the attached tier matrix before Thursday's session. The confidential summary of our forward business plans appears immediately below.

board note of yadup-fajef: Druiusox Holdings is in early talks to buy Norwynek Systems for about $186.0 million. The Kaseth launch date is June 24, and nothing goes to the press before then. Legal wants the Quenethek Group term sheet withdrawn before November 27.

Subject: ParcelPing webhook cut-over — done

Hey Rilo — cut-over went smoothly last night. The parcel-tracking webhook now fires from the new dispatcher, old endpoint is drained, and nothing queued up during the switch. One thing to eyeball in review: the new dispatcher runs with these configuration values:

deployment values, bajop-yahaf:
[holax]
host = holax.tolvaqsys.corp
user = holax_svc
database = holax_prod